Morra Population - Rajsamand, Rajasthan

Morra is a medium size village located in Railmagra Tehsil of Rajsamand district, Rajasthan with total 228 families residing. The Morra village has population of 1096 of which 560 are males while 536 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Morra village population of children with age 0-6 is 108 which makes up 9.85 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Morra village is 957 which is higher than Rajasthan state average of 928. Child Sex Ratio for the Morra as per census is 1250, higher than Rajasthan average of 888.

Morra village has lower literacy rate compared to Rajasthan. In 2011, literacy rate of Morra village was 56.98 % compared to 66.11 % of Rajasthan. In Morra Male literacy stands at 74.61 % while female literacy rate was 38.03 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 6.75 % while Schedule Caste (SC) were 2.46 % of total population in Morra village.

Work Profile

In Morra village out of total population, 644 were engaged in work activities. 79.19 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 20.81 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 644 workers engaged in Main Work, 386 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 71 were Agricultural labourer.
